Capital solutions
Our primary focus is private credit, particularly asset-based lending, trade finance and transaction-led credit.
Secured equipment, receivables and other asset-backed facilities.
Inventory, purchase-order and transaction-led working capital.
Short- to medium-term credit for expansion, working-capital execution and transitional funding needs.
Structured debt, credit-linked note solutions, ring-fenced vehicles, syndicated facilities and bespoke structures.
Where relevant to the capital-provider mandate, we consider measurable development and UN Sustainable Development Goal alignment alongside financial viability. Impact alignment is a consideration across financing structures, not a separate instrument.

Who executes
CEO
Miltiades leads SHC’s strategic direction, transaction origination and capital-provider relationships. His experience spans private credit, asset-based lending, venture-capital advisory and investment management.
BSc Property Investment & Finance · University of Cape Town
COO · Head of Quality Control
Kimon oversees deal triage, credit analysis, structure and diligence. His background spans alternative investments, macro research, securities trading and operational management, including principal authorship of SHC’s white paper on asset-based private debt.
Business Science in Finance (Honours) · University of Cape Town
